Otto Valstad

Otto Valstad (11 December 1862 20 June 1950) was a Norwegian painter, book illustrator and children's writer. He was born in Asker, and was married to Tilla Valstad. Their home in Hvalstad was a cultural centre, and has later been made into a museum, a part of Asker Museum. Among his books are Juletræet from 1891, Smaakarer from 1910, Ola Enfoldig from 1916 and Ola Mangfoldig from 1923. He is represented in the National Gallery of Norway with the portrait Fru Lina Brun from 1901.[1][2]
